用两个指针就行,一个指针i初始时指向头元素,另一个j指向下标为1的元素(所以说,当长度为1时单独判断,长度为1就返回1) 之后,如果i下标的元素等于j下标的元素,j++,假如到了i和j代表的元素不等时,说明i,j中间这些都是重复元素,都是等于nums[i]的元素,此时,nums[i+1]=nums[ ...
分类:
编程语言 时间:
2020-05-04 14:59:43
阅读次数:
59
不用申请内存空间,把一个字符串做反正操作。比如说:str=”abcdefg”res=”gfedcba”这个比较简单,只要做前后字符交换就可以了funcreverse(str[]byte){i:=0j:=len(str)-1fori<j{str[i],str[j]=str[j],str[i]i++j--}}第二阶段不用申请内存,如何把每个单词做反转,假设单词中间只有一个空格比如说:str=“p
分类:
其他好文 时间:
2020-05-04 14:59:29
阅读次数:
51
在第六篇中已经学习过了自定义信号的相关内容了,那一篇中讲的是自定义类中的自定义信号,类和信号都是自己定义的。那么今天想要学习的是事件处理和信号的关系。如同Label标签,它本身有很多的信号,但是它没有当鼠标双击时的事件。那么我们想要实现效果,就要自己写一个label对象,让它添加这个功能。 效果图: ...
分类:
其他好文 时间:
2020-05-04 14:58:38
阅读次数:
125
人脸识别是图像处理与OpenCV非常重要的应用之一,opencv官方专门有教程和代码讲解其实现方法。此示例程序就是使用objdetect模块检测摄像头视频流中的人脸,位于...\opencv\sources\samples\cpp\tutorial_code\objectDetection路径之下。 ...
分类:
其他好文 时间:
2020-05-04 14:57:27
阅读次数:
54
在Django项目中,我们需要用到数据库时,通常有两种方式实现创建和同步数据库 1、直接在models.py文件中写方法,然后再同步到数据库中 class UserName(models.Model): id = models.IntegerField() name = models.CharFie ...
分类:
数据库 时间:
2020-05-04 13:51:12
阅读次数:
68
import requestsdef A(): try: r=requests.get(url) r.raise_for_status() r.encoding='utf-8' return r.text except: return ""url="https://baike.baidu.com/i ...
分类:
其他好文 时间:
2020-05-04 13:50:39
阅读次数:
62
PHP常见的数组遍历方式 在PHP开发中,数组是我们最用的PHP函数之一,并且对于数组函数的遍历方式也有很多种,如果我们熟悉PHP数组的遍历方式以及每种方式的优缺点,会让我们的程序优雅需求,不管是开发效率还是代码的执行效率上都会得到大大的提升。直线导轨滑台 1、foreach 这是我们最常见的遍历之 ...
分类:
编程语言 时间:
2020-05-04 13:50:23
阅读次数:
84
维护自己的代码片段,传 Demo 实例的时候,总会有人不留神就提交了不该提交的代码,如公司的数据库连接信息。 这种情况下等你反应过来后,该如何删掉你之前的提交记录呢? 创建一个叫new_start的分支,改分支没有任何历史记录,但是所有文件都会原封不动的存在。 然后你编辑文件后,删掉不该传的东西后, ...
分类:
其他好文 时间:
2020-05-04 13:50:05
阅读次数:
72
初识OSPF 说明:学习ing...若有不对之处,欢迎指出 1 OSPF简介 OSPF协议是一种链路状态协议。每个路由器负责发现、维护与邻居的关系,并将已知的邻居列表和链路费用LSU(Link State Update)报文描述,通过可靠的泛洪与自治系统AS(Autonomous System)内的 ...
分类:
其他好文 时间:
2020-05-04 13:49:47
阅读次数:
96
题目: 解答: 1 class Solution { 2 public: 3 string complexNumberMultiply(string a, string b) 4 { 5 int a1 = stoi(a); 6 int b1 = stoi(b); 7 8 int i = 0; 9 i ...
分类:
其他好文 时间:
2020-05-04 13:49:29
阅读次数:
58
导读: 数据湖概念的诞生,源自企业面临的一些挑战,如数据应该以何种方式处理和存储。最开始,企业对种类庞杂的应用程序的管理都经历了一个比较自然的演化周期。 最开始的时候,每个应用程序会产生、存储大量数据,而这些数据并不能被其他应用程序使用,这种状况导致 数据孤岛 的产生。随后数据集市应运而生,应用程序 ...
分类:
其他好文 时间:
2020-05-04 13:49:08
阅读次数:
64
二、方发之间的区别: 1、PUT和POST PUT和POS都有更改指定URI的语义.但PUT被定义为idempotent的方法,POST则不是.idempotent的方法:如果一个方法重复执行 多次,产生的效果是一样的,那就是idempotent的。也就是说: PUT请求:如果两个请求相同,后一个请 ...
分类:
其他好文 时间:
2020-05-04 13:48:52
阅读次数:
50
CNPM,淘宝 NPM 镜像,同步官方版本频率为10分钟一次 cnpm的两种使用方式: 切换到淘宝镜像源 安装 cnpm,然后用 cnpm 代替 npm 切换到淘宝镜像源 安装cnpm ...
分类:
其他好文 时间:
2020-05-04 13:48:39
阅读次数:
58
1 Navicat 可以说是众多程序猿小伙伴的忠爱了,因为界面简洁且操作简单,让我们爱不释手;最近Navicat Premium 15发布了, 让我们来看看如何安装永久激活版哦(简称白嫖版) 2|0Navicat Premium 15安装 安装软件包和注册机放这自取了哈 如果15装不了,就装里面的1 ...
分类:
其他好文 时间:
2020-05-04 13:48:08
阅读次数:
369
第一种: 1 2 $file = 'x.y.z.png'; echo substr(strrchr($file, '.'), 1); 解析:strrchr($file, '.') strrchr() 函数查找字符串在另一个字符串中最后一次出现的位置,并返回从该位置到字符串结尾的所有字符直线导轨滑台 ...
分类:
Web程序 时间:
2020-05-04 13:47:47
阅读次数:
68
五月中旬 十天 做简历? 名词解释,选择,计算,论述题 背名词解释 做题、练习题库 实事金融 笔试、英文面试、中文面试 ...
分类:
其他好文 时间:
2020-05-04 13:47:16
阅读次数:
46
学校又有新的课程要观看了,没办法,只能上才艺了 对于像这种网课类的观看,发送的数据请求一般都是ajax,携带的关键参数大致如下 + 当前的观看时间 + 当前观看的课程章节id + 当前课程的id 随便找了一个课程,发送的数据如下 因为我已经分析过了,就直接告诉大家,发送数据的参数只有enc是不断变化 ...
分类:
其他好文 时间:
2020-05-04 13:46:58
阅读次数:
481